Abstract

Investigating the Kapur et al. (1985) image thresholding method, we found, that taking the sum of the Havrda and Charvat entropies as a criterion for threshold selection instead of the Shannon entropies, can result in a better image segmentation in the sense of greater uniformity of the partitioned segments, as well as greater contrast among segments.
